We went last year and I only booked it 2 weeks prior to our trip. The show was almost sold out. Our seats were on the second level and they were terrific seats. I don't think there are too many bad seats in the house! Maybe the seats in the back of the first level, but it is pretty small in there. The show spills out into the audience and they come around to the tables at times. Click on these two pics to see a couple of pics I took from our seats. The seats on the second level all are along the rail and you look down on the show. Your table runs parellel with the rail and you turn around on your stool to watch the show. In any event, the theater is layed out so that there's really not a bad seat. The performers show up all over the hall, not just on the stage, and the stage is elevated enough that even from the back, you can see just fine. You will be seated around a table, and your seats do not have numbers. Tables of different sizes are located throughout, so there's really no way for you to know where you will be seated prior to showtime.
